White Fused Alumina is a special material used in many industries. It is made from aluminum oxide, which is a strong and hard substance. This material is often used for making products like sandpaper, grinding wheels, and even bricks that can withstand very high temperatures. Installation Guidance for White Fused Alumina in Refractory Uses
Installing white fused alumina for refractory uses can be quite simple if you follow some basic steps. Refractory materials are used to line furnaces, kilns, and other high-temperature equipment. First, make sure you have all the necessary tools and safety gear. This includes gloves, masks, and goggles to protect yourself while working. Before you start, clean the area where you will be installing the white fused alumina. Remove any dust, dirt, or old materials. This ensures that the new material will stick properly.
Next, mix the white fused alumina with a binder. A binder is a substance that helps hold the materials together. Follow the instructions that come with the binder to ensure you mix the right amount. Once mixed, you can start applying the material. Use a trowel or a similar tool to spread the mixture evenly over the surface. Be sure to fill any gaps or cracks so that the lining is smooth and strong. After applying the mixture, allow it to cure. Curing is the process where the material hardens and sets. This can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days, depending on the binder you used. Once cured, check for any weak spots and patch them if necessary.

Comparing White Fused Alumina to Other Abrasive Materials
When it comes to abrasives, there are many types available. White fused alumina is one of them, and it has some unique features that make it stand out. One of the main advantages of white fused alumina is its hardness. It is very tough and can cut through materials like metal and stone easily. This makes it great for making sandpaper and grinding wheels. Compared to other abrasives like garnet or silicon carbide, white fused alumina is often more durable. It can last longer, which means you don’t have to replace it as often.
Another benefit of white fused alumina is its purity. It is made from high-quality aluminum oxide, which means it has fewer impurities than some other abrasives. This makes it safer to use and helps create a better finish on the surfaces you are working on. For example, if you are using it to polish metal, it will give a smoother and shinier finish compared to other materials. However, it is important to mention that white fused alumina can be more expensive than some other abrasives. But, because it lasts longer and performs better, many people believe it is worth the investment.
In terms of applications, white fused alumina is widely used in both abrasive and refractory industries. While other materials may be better suited for specific tasks, white fused alumina is versatile. It can be used for anything from cutting tools to refractories in furnaces.
